WebOct 8, 2024 · Note: For floors that will be carpeted, there’s no reason to rest base right on the floor. You can avoid a tilted baseboard by raising it above the drywall gap. Cut a few 3/8- to 1/2-inch thick spacers (6-inch scraps of standard base will do). Lay them flat on the floor every few feet. Cut the base to fit. Rest it on the spacers and nail it ... WebMar 13, 2024 · Without an expansion gap, laminate floors would buckle as the material took on moisture in the air. Spacers help create the gap when you install the floor. Typically, laminate flooring calls for a gap of 3/8-inch to 1/2-inch. Spacers often come with the flooring, or you may purchase them separately.
